Country/Territory Zimbabwe Document type Legislation Date 1985 (2016) Source FAO, FAOLEX Subject General Keyword Framework law Access-to-justice Legal proceedings/administrative proceedings Basic legislation Business/industry/corporations Capacity building Contract/agreement Dispute settlement Equity Gender Governance Offences/penalties Procedural matters Social protection Youth Geographical area Africa, Eastern Africa, Landlocked Developing Nations Abstract This Act comprising 128 Articles organized into XV Parts aims to advance social justice and democracy in the workplace by (i) giving effect to the fundamental rights of employees provided for under Part II; (ii) providing a legal framework within which employees and employers can bargain collectively for the improvement of conditions of employment; (iii) promoting fair labor standards; (iv) promoting participation by employees in decisions affecting their interests in the workplace; (v) securing the just, effective and expeditious resolution of disputes and unfair labor practices.
